DASYLab 11 has a point-and-click interface that lets users set up data acquisition routines quickly. Individual measurement or analysis applications can be created in a few minutes.
In the new version, the diagram-module supports trigger data and allows the display of the reference curve. In all modules, channel-selection is enabled using hotkeys.
Other new features include:
- Copying of the variable-range
- Additional support of SMTP in the Email-module: no email-client will be needed to send emails
- Graphical reference curve editor
- Support for long path names
- Four more DAP-models and driver
- DASYLab NI-CAN-driver now supports USB
- Support for the current Vector CAN-driver
- Automatic recognition of the Vector-driver-version
- Supports the current IXXAT CAN-driver
- Automatic recognition of the IXXAT-driver-version
- Mouse wheel support (vertical and horizontal)
- Sliding of the current worksheet with the mouse
DASYLab 11 is supplied and supported by Adept Scientific in the UK and Ireland.
